Matrix Recruitment is working with a key client, who are a leading medical device company based in Westmeath. They are seeking to hire a Commodity Manager to join their team. This position is a 1 yeat fixed term contract. The Commodity Manager will be responsible for establishing and implementing strategic plans for the Supply management. You will also be responsible for the up keep of a supply base ensuring materials are delivered in a time-efficient manner and within the company’s budget. You will work as part of a team and report to the Director of Global Sourcing. SALARY: €60-€65K. Your new job. You will be responbile for the management of commerical relationships to ensure there is a readily supply available for the manufacture of products. Manage and introduce sourcing plans for commodities in support of continuous operations. Organise and execute reviews for contract agreements and to evaluate the performance of suppliers and establish improvement plans for key suppliers. Supports continuous managment of risk assessments and business reviews. Establish Early Supplier Involvement Programs to improve standards and lower costs. Liaise with investors within manufacturing both internal and external, Quality, Engineering and Supply Chain to form and carry out business opportunities and resolve situations in a professional manner. Frequent reporting on key subjects to senior management. Examine data to identify opportunites and follow through with decisions to drive the company. Support procedures monthly SBR Schedule reporting, S&OP reporting, monthly PPV reporting, semi-annual risk assessments and semi-annual sourcing team off-sites etc. Manage and ensure conformity across the supply base as fitting e.g BAA/TAA, RoHS, C-TPAT, Dodd-Frank, REACH, etc. What we are looking for. Masters or Bacherlors degree in Engineering / Business/Supply Chain. 5-7 years experience in purchasing management within a multinational manufacturing environment. Sourcing/Supplier management of multiple suppliers, negotiating contracts and establishing a second-source supply base. Knowledge and experience in an ongoing deadline driven environment with a proven recording of cost reductions and savings annually. Technical knowledge of medical devices and able to understand complex items related to customer and equipment specifications. Demonstrated negotiation and a combining style of work to achieve results. Experiece with MS Office i.e. Advanced Excel , Word, Power Point and Access.Oracle eperience would be a distinct advantage. Travel requirements (international & domestic) – between 10% to 20%. Six Sigma/Lean certification, professional certification (CPSM, CSCP, CPM, CPIM.
